IN LOVING MEMORY OF
Chevaughn Tara
Mcclain
September 10, 1978 – June 9, 2025
On September 10, 1978, a beautiful baby girl was born to
Jennifer McClain and Bernard Edwards in Muskogee,
Oklahoma. This precious daughter was named Chevaughn
Tara McClain.
Chevaughn grew up in Muskogee, OK. She was the oldest of
two children in the family and was a member of Little Rose
Baptist Church.
During her youth, Chevaughn enjoyed volunteering at the
hospital as a Candy Striper. It was there that she learned the
value of giving and caring for others. She would later move to
Tulsa, Oklahoma, where she attended Nathan Hale High
School with the graduating Class of 1997. She was a proud
member of the Black Heritage Club while at Nathan Hale.
Chevaughn continued her work serving as a Cafeteria Food
Service Manager for Tulsa Public Schools, which she enjoyed
greatly. She was committed to serving the children of Tulsa
Public Schools until she received her greatest job yet,
becoming a mother.
Being a mom was her greatest gift and greatest joy. While
serving others and being the best mom she could be, she was
fighting her toughest battle as a sickle cell warrior. Chevaughn
was also involved with several local sickle cell organizations,
where she would volunteer her time and enjoyed being in
community with others like herself who were fighting to
survive.
On June 9th, 2025, she lost that battle but received her Crown
and gained the Victory over death, joining her son, Ta
'Ron Capers, her Mom, Jennifer McClain and her Dad, Bernard
Edwards in Heaven.
She leaves a beautiful memory in the hearts of her family; her
children, Tristan Capers and Embrie Bonner, both of Tulsa,
OK; her brother, Brandon Mayfield, Tulsa, OK; her sister,
Kendra Olmstead (Keith), Muskogee, OK; two nieces, one
nephew, her loving grandmother, Jeannette Edwards; and a
caravan of aunts, uncles, cousins and friends who will miss
her dearly.
